Loading Video…
This browser does not support the Video element.
World Cup Preview: France vs Iraq in Philadelphia
Reporter Chris O'Connell is in Philadelphia Stadium giving a peek of what to expect for the France/Iraq FIFA World Cup matchup.
This browser does not support the Video element.
Reporter Chris O'Connell is in Philadelphia Stadium giving a peek of what to expect for the France/Iraq FIFA World Cup matchup.